   Sec. 15. If the drainage board finds for the petitioner under section 14(a) of this chapter, the board shall determine, based upon a preponderance of the evidence, whether the obstruction of the drain or natural surface watercourse was created intentionally by any of the respondents.

As added by P.L.239-1996, SEC.3 and P.L.240-1996, SEC.2.
